AUDIT CHECKLIST — Item 14: Documentation linter

Verify that the Quillgate doc linter runs on every merge request touching the /docs tree in the Fernhollow repository. Confirm the ruleset version matches the one pinned in the style guide, that broken-link checks are enabled, and that suppressions carry a written justification. As a new contractor, do not modify linter rules yourself; flag any failing or skipped runs in the audit log. Escalate unresolved findings to the linter owner, whose name appears below.

approver of yajef-fajef = Oliwyn Silion Kasok Kasox

### Metrics sidecar auth

Heads-up for review: the Grainscope sidecar scrapes process metrics every ten seconds and ships them to the internal Tallyhouse aggregator over mTLS, so there's no inbound surface on the sidecar itself. The only credential in play is the Tallyhouse ingest key, which the sidecar reads from its mounted config at startup — it never logs it and never forwards it downstream. Scope is write-only to the `metrics.ingest` route. For completeness of this review, the current key is included below.

app token of tagef-tafog = qvz3-7n0

Ticket: Vaultkeep sealed — CSV import wizard blocked. The Orrindale import wizard cannot fetch column-mapping templates because the Vaultkeep secrets store auto-locked after three failed unseal attempts during last night's maintenance. Customers mid-import see a spinner at the mapping step; no data loss, but retries queue up fast. On-call: do not restart the wizard pods first — unseal Vaultkeep, then drain the retry queue in order. The unseal console on the standby node accepts the recovery passphrase provided below.

unlock words, fadug-tageg: zorix-wenwyn-quenmir

☐ Off-site run: spare parts for the Dunmoor relay station. Verify all four cartons against the parts list twice — the actuator seals and the backup valve kit are irreplaceable this quarter. Seal each carton with numbered tape and photograph the seals before loading. The Keldway courier collects at 06:45 sharp; the confidential hand-over instruction to relay is recorded immediately below this item.

handover note for yagef-bagep: the drudor pelius courier leaves the kasdor zorvan norir ledger at gate 8016 under passcode 755406